English summary on page 58 as follows: Custom of jar burial is a popular form of burying of ancient habitants in Vietnam. This known custom came into being in Neolithic in Tay Nguyen and has developed till early iron periods of Pau Tro, Sa Huynh and Dong Son cultures. Especially, it was a traditional burying in Sa Huynh culture, from the early period to the late one, and jars were buried in the same standing position as those of burialsin Tay Nguyen and Bau Tro. In the mean time, jars were buried in horizontal position in Dong Son culture. Jar burials in Vietnam have developed and changed through historic periods, which are marked by the changes of jars in form, lids, buried position and its accompanied artifacts.
